NESD FARM - 6/23/2024 13:08

How are cc adding to profitability of farm? Appears to have poor seedbed/stand establishment, severe insect pressure, extra equipment, extra time managing a crop that can't be harvested. I can understand holding the ground if it's hel ground, but otherwise what's the benefits that have been measured via the pocketbook?


Aside from helping with erosion I think our soil is much better
We are raising great yields on not very great soil types
We question every $ spent --
--No side by sides "before you ask" --we've been doing this in some form mostly forever


SO we think it pays BUT no way to prove it
